As already indicated, tolerance can be defined as the magnitude of permissible variation of a dimension or other measured or control criterion from the specified value. Tolerances have to be allowed because of the inevitable human failings and machine limitations ...

These are used for checking the straightness and flatness of parts in conjunction with the surface plates and spirit levels. These may be made of steel or cast iron. Steel straight edges are available up to 2 m length ...
